Application


  • Enhanced versus standard hydration in acute ischaemic stroke: REVIVE - a randomized clinical trial.: This clinical trial investigates the efficacy of sodium chloride in enhanced hydration protocols for patients with acute ischemic stroke, aiming to improve clinical outcomes. (Lin et al., 2024).

  • A Coalescing Filter for Liquid-Liquid Separation and Multistage Extraction in Continuous-Flow Chemistry.: Sodium chloride is utilized in developing a coalescing filter for efficient liquid-liquid separation and extraction processes in continuous-flow chemistry. (Daglish et al., 2024).
